A large fire is burning in the Crowley Lake to McGee Creek area. This in spite of rain in the town of Mammoth Lakes and light rain at the Mammoth Airport. Evacuations are in progress in the community of Crowley Lake and the small community of McGee Creek. U.S. 395, both north and south bound is closed from Toms Place (25 miles north of Bishop) to Benton Crossing Road. Inyo NF, Cal Fire, Long Valley FD, Mammoth FD, June Lake FD, and Bridgeport FD on scene. Air Attack and 4 air tankers committed. There is some confusion regarding directions in the area of this fire. This is likely caused by people thinking that U.S. 395 in the fires area is aligned north south. This highway, in the area of Tom's Place to the Mammoth Lakes turnoff is actually aligned southeast to northwest. In the area of the fire it is nearly aligned east west. The fire started somewhere south of the small community of McGee Creek which is slightly a northwest direction from the community of Crowley Lake. This explains why the fire moved northbound toward the lake or Lake Crowley. It more or less burned itself out after crossing the highway because the vegetation near the lake becomes marshy.

The fire began to move northeast toward the community of Crowley Lake and that prompted the evacuations
